地牢龙项目信息化进展:深入探讨JavaScript技术

需积分: 5 0 下载量 55 浏览量 更新于2024-11-09 收藏 7.87MB ZIP 举报
资源摘要信息:"donjon-dragons:信息化项目" 一、项目概述 本项目标题为“donjon-dragons:信息化项目”,主要涉及到一个名为“地牢龙”的分支项目,标识为“dds01 IT 项目”。项目中可能包含了一系列的IT开发活动,如系统设计、编码、测试以及部署等。由于描述中包含了大量重复的感叹号,这可能表明项目具有紧急性或特殊性,需要特别注意。 二、技术栈分析 从提供的标签“JavaScript”可知,该项目在开发过程中主要使用了JavaScript语言。JavaScript是一种广泛应用于网页开发的脚本语言,它具有轻量级、解释执行和跨平台的特性。JavaScript通常用于实现网页的动态效果、异步数据交换和客户端逻辑。因此,该项目很可能涉及到Web前端开发或Node.js环境下的后端开发。 三、文件结构分析 “压缩包子文件的文件名称列表”中仅包含了一个名称“donjon-dragons-master”。这个名称很可能代表了该项目的主干代码库或版本控制系统中的主分支(master branch)。通常情况下,在版本控制系统(如Git)中,“master”分支被认为是项目的稳定版本,所有的开发工作都是基于这个主分支进行的。由于名称中没有包含子目录或具体的文件名,我们无法直接判断出项目的具体文件结构和内容,但可以推测项目具有一定的规模,因为通常只有较为复杂的项目才会使用版本控制系统管理。 四、可能涉及的知识点 1. 信息化项目管理:项目管理是确保项目按时、按预算和以规定的质量完成的关键。它涉及到需求分析、资源分配、时间规划、风险管理、质量控制等多个方面。在信息化项目中,还需要特别关注数据安全、用户隐私保护和系统集成等问题。 2. IT项目生命周期:一般包括启动、规划、执行、监控和收尾五个阶段。每个阶段都有其特定的任务和目标,且相互依赖,循环迭代。 3. 前端开发:使用JavaScript、HTML和CSS等技术对网页的外观、交互和内容进行开发。前端开发者需要关注用户体验、页面响应式设计和跨浏览器兼容性。 4. 后端开发(Node.js):使用Node.js进行后端开发可以让开发者使用JavaScript语言编写服务器端代码,包括数据处理、API服务等。Node.js由于其异步非阻塞的特性,特别适合于处理高并发请求。 5. 版本控制:Git是目前广泛使用的一款分布式版本控制系统,通过“donjon-dragons-master”可以推测项目使用了Git进行代码版本的管理。掌握Git的基本命令和工作流程对于参与项目的每个成员都是必不可少的技能。 6. 项目紧急性或特殊性处理:由于项目描述中使用了大量感叹号,暗示了项目的紧急性或特殊性,团队成员可能需要具备应对突发事件的能力,例如迅速解决问题、适应快速变化的需求或是在压力下工作。 五、建议 在参与或管理此类项目时,建议明确项目目标、合理规划时间线和资源,确保团队成员之间有良好的沟通协作。同时,由于项目可能涉及到复杂的应用场景,应当注重技术选型和架构设计,以确保系统的可扩展性和稳定性。此外,对于任何紧急或特殊状况,应提前制定应对措施和预案,以便高效应对可能发生的突发情况。